For many years, asbestos seemed like a miracle material, used in buildings, insulation, and even consumer products. Yet, exposure to its fibers caused severe health problems such as lung disease, mesothelioma, and long-term respiratory issues.

Historical Lessons
The widespread use of asbestos in the 20th century demonstrates how industries can sometimes prioritize efficiency over safety. Communities discovered too late the long-lasting health implications of exposure. It carries these lessons forward, showing that innovation without safeguards can become harmful.
Today, many countries have banned or heavily restricted asbestos, but its legacy still lingers in older buildings and infrastructures. The challenge is not only about removing existing risks but also ensuring that future innovations undergo careful evaluation.
